Canyonleigh is a high growth suburb in Wingecarribee, NSW 2577, about 121km from Sydney CBD. Its median house price of $1.79M is more expensive than the NSW average. The suburb has no schools recorded, a transport score of 0/100, and is about 67km inland. Canyonleigh has an overall score of 22/100, based on transport, liveability and education. Suburb-level crime data isn't available for a safety score here.
